云原生部署实战:高效弹性扩容架构方案
|
在云原生环境中,自动化脚本编写者需要深入理解容器化、编排工具以及弹性扩容机制。通过编写高效的脚本,可以实现应用的自动部署与动态资源调整。 采用Kubernetes作为核心编排平台,能够有效管理容器生命周期,并支持基于负载的自动扩缩容。脚本需集成HPA(Horizontal Pod Autoscaler)和VPA(Vertical Pod Autoscaler),以适应不同场景下的资源需求。 在实际部署中,脚本应具备监控能力,通过Prometheus等工具采集指标,如CPU使用率、请求延迟等,为扩缩容决策提供数据支撑。同时,结合告警系统,确保在异常情况下及时响应。 为了提升效率,脚本应尽量减少人工干预,实现从代码提交到部署的全自动化流程。CI/CD管道的构建是关键环节,需确保每个阶段的稳定性与可重复性。 在设计弹性架构时,需考虑多可用区部署和跨区域容灾策略。脚本应能根据地理位置和网络状况智能调度实例,避免单点故障影响整体服务。 日志与追踪系统的集成也是不可忽视的部分。通过ELK栈或OpenTelemetry,脚本能实时分析运行状态,辅助优化资源配置和故障排查。
AI渲染效果图,仅供参考 最终,持续优化脚本逻辑,结合A/B测试和灰度发布策略,确保新版本上线后的稳定性和性能表现。自动化脚本不仅是工具,更是云原生架构的核心驱动力。 (编辑:52站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

